The Road Development Authority (RDA) states that due to the disasters caused by the prevailing adverse weather conditions, only 95 roads are currently obstructed for traffic. In recent days, 256 roads under the authority were damaged due to floods and landslides.
However, Mr. Wimal Kandambi, Director General of the Road Development Authority, stated that access to all major cities in the island has now been restored. He emphasized that efforts are underway to completely clear the remaining road obstructions within the next few days.
Officials, including the Authority's engineering teams, have already commenced operations to swiftly remove road obstructions. The Director General also announced that the main Colombo-Nuwara Eliya road, which was closed due to obstructions, especially in the Kadugannawa area, is scheduled to reopen for traffic today.
The Road Development Authority further revealed that in addition to the road network, 20 bridges have also been damaged and destroyed due to this disaster situation.
